Astral Copies are one of the enemy types in Control. They are encountered in the Astral Plane in the main game and in the Foundation in The Foundation.

History[]

Astral Copies were initially encountered not in the Astral Plane, but in the Foundation, on September 14, 1964. Dr. Theodore Ash, Jr. referred to them as "the Id," after Freud's theory describing the primitive, basic, unconscious part of the personality. At the time they were, if not friendly, at least non-hostile. Ash even named a few of them: Hercules (Id #3), Adam, Lillith, Copernicus, and Mabel (Id #11). The Id showed Ash many depictions of an inverted black triangle painted onto the cave walls of the Foundation, his first exposure to what he later learned from Director Northmoor was The Board.

On October 29, the Id began to turn hostile, leading to two fatalities, and prompting the FBC to evacuate the Foundation. One of the last to leave, Ash claimed that he had become aware of hidden connections between Northmoor, The Nail, the Service Weapon, and the Id.

Once the Foundation had been abandoned and its existence classified, further encounters with the Id seemed to be limited to the Astral Plane. Their origins forgotten, they were renamed as Astral Copies.

Research Summary[]

According to reports compiled by Emily Pope, the Copies’ bodies are composed of dense dark gray stone-like material that is both resilient under controlled circumstances and brittle when struck with significant force. It is unclear whether the Astral Copies possess individual consciousness or are directed by a higher intelligence (such as the Board), however their shared aggression seems to indicate a unified goal.

Astral Copies appear during the 'training segments' in the Astral Plane that the player is transported to, whenever binding an Object of Power. Here, they seemingly fulfill the role of targets to for growing parautilitatians to practice newly gained abilities on. They can also be encountered in the Astral Bleeds in the Foundation, and are hostile to both the player as well as the Hiss enemies found there.

There is a variant of Astral Copies composed of a gold material; these variants are immune to direct attacks, and serve as special targets for Jesse to learn to use certain paranatural abilities (for example, using Seize on a dark gray Copy, and then that gray Copy can attack the gold Copy).
